    March 26, 2006 at 10:42 am in reply to: Capture / pre-roll problem, help please !

    capture now, just do capture now and begin playing,

    there are a few reason forpreroll, and one of those is to get the tape up to speed, so if there are isues with your tape (little min dv’s not so much but larger hd tape etc get troublesome)

    but capture now will basicly let you capture anything rolling through your heads, so just do capture now, and then press play on your tape deck.

    March 26, 2006 at 5:46 am in reply to: Artifacts on Red Channel

    [walter biscardi] “Also, in After Effects, just render to the DV codec if you’re finishing to DV. It’s a waste of time to render in animation and then have FCP re-render the thing down to DV. You’ll get a cleaner end product letting After Effects create the DV file.”
